Stacey Abrams

Former Minority Leader, Georgia House of Representatives, United States of America

Stacey Abrams is a New York Times bestselling author, entrepreneur, and political leader. She served as Minority Leader in the Georgia House of Representatives, and was the first Black woman to become a gubernatorial nominee for a major party in United States history. Stacey has devoted her career to democracy protection, voting rights, and effective public policy. She has also co-founded successful companies, including a financial services firm, an energy and infrastructure consulting firm, and the media company Sage Works Productions, Inc. Stacey is a Salzburg Global Fellow.
